A rapidly growing, market-leading boutique city law firm is seeking a junior commercial litigation lawyer to join a highly established Dispute Resolution team dealing with public interest and insolvency matters, and Director Disqualifications – acting for both Insolvency and Director Stakeholders.

Applicants should have some noteworthy litigation experience across commercial litigation and insolvency and must show a desire to take on Director Disqualification work. Full training will be provided, but candidates must have relevant training within adjourning areas. Any exposure focussed on tax litigation is particularly desirable as is the ability to assist with marketing legal services online.

The successful candidate will likely be au fait with the insolvency service, the treasury solicitor, and/or the providers of legal services to the secretary of state. There is significant scope for successful applicants to contribute to the firm’s publications and for client and business development from an early stage. The firm also offers a superb benefits structure, whereby a discretionary firm-wide bonus scheme and a fee earner bonus both provide substantial opportunities to boost financial prospects.
